Dual Frequency GPR Systems are ground-penetrating radar systems that can operate at two different frequencies simultaneously or independently. These systems provide two different depths of penetration and resolutions for detecting subsurface features and structures. The lower frequency provides deeper penetration for larger objects or structures while the higher frequency provides higher resolution for smaller objects or structures closer to the surface.
